Skip to content

Commit 55674e4

Browse files
committed
fix(Dashboard): Reverted property extensions property name, introduced by a badly synched branch
1 parent 871d2a2 commit 55674e4

File tree

7 files changed

+90
-1106
lines changed

7 files changed

+90
-1106
lines changed

src/core/Synapse.Integration/Models/v1/V1Event.cs

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-55,9 +55,9 @@ IEnumerable<KeyValuePair<string, string>> AttributesEnumerator
5555
yield return new KeyValuePair<string, string>(nameof(Subject).ToLower(), this.Subject);
5656
if (this.Time.HasValue)
5757
yield return new KeyValuePair<string, string>(nameof(Time).ToLower(), this.Time.ToString()!);
58-
if(this.Extensions != null)
58+
if(this.ExtensionAttributes != null)
5959
{
60-
foreach (var extension in this.Extensions)
60+
foreach (var extension in this.ExtensionAttributes)
6161
yield return new(extension.Key, extension.Value.ToString()!);
6262
}
6363
}
@@ -129,8 +129,8 @@ public void SetAttribute(string name, string value)
129129
else
130130
{
131131
var dynamicValue = value == null ? null : Dynamic.FromObject(value);
132-
if (this.Extensions == null) this.Extensions = new();
133-
this.Extensions[name.ToLowerInvariant()] = dynamicValue;
132+
if (this.ExtensionAttributes == null) this.ExtensionAttributes = new();
133+
this.ExtensionAttributes[name.ToLowerInvariant()] = dynamicValue;
134134
}
135135
}
136136

@@ -172,10 +172,10 @@ public static V1Event CreateFrom(CloudEvent cloudEvent)
172172
};
173173
if(cloudEvent.ExtensionAttributes != null)
174174
{
175-
e.Extensions = new();
175+
e.ExtensionAttributes = new();
176176
foreach (var extensionsAttribute in cloudEvent.ExtensionAttributes)
177177
{
178-
e.Extensions.Add(extensionsAttribute.Name, Dynamic.FromObject(extensionsAttribute.Format(cloudEvent[extensionsAttribute]!)));
178+
e.ExtensionAttributes.Add(extensionsAttribute.Name, Dynamic.FromObject(extensionsAttribute.Format(cloudEvent[extensionsAttribute]!)));
179179
}
180180
}
181181
return e;
@@ -198,9 +198,9 @@ public CloudEvent ToCloudEvent()
198198
DataSchema = this.DataSchema,
199199
Data = this.Data?.ToObject()
200200
};
201-
if(this.Extensions != null)
201+
if(this.ExtensionAttributes != null)
202202
{
203-
foreach (var attribute in this.Extensions)
203+
foreach (var attribute in this.ExtensionAttributes)
204204
{
205205
e[attribute.Key] = attribute.Value.ToObject();
206206
}

src/dashboard/Synapse.Dashboard/Features/Shared/Layout/Header.razor.css

Lines changed: 0 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,6 @@
1919
.header.auth {
2020
justify-content: space-between;
2121
}
22-
2322
.header a, .header .btn-link {
2423
margin-left: 0;
2524
}

src/dashboard/Synapse.Dashboard/Features/Shared/Layout/NavMenu.razor.min.css

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

src/dashboard/Synapse.Dashboard/Features/Shared/PublishEventModal/PublishEventModal.razor

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-74,9 +74,9 @@
7474
<h6>Extension attributes</h6>
7575
<table class="table table-striped mb-3">
7676
<tbody>
77-
@if (cloudEvent != null && cloudEvent.Extensions != null)
77+
@if (cloudEvent != null && cloudEvent.ExtensionAttributes != null)
7878
{
79-
foreach (var attr in cloudEvent.Extensions)
79+
foreach (var attr in cloudEvent.ExtensionAttributes)
8080
{
8181
<tr>
8282
<td>@attr.Key</td>
@@ -172,16 +172,16 @@
172172
private void OnRemoveExtensionAttribute(string name)
173173
{
174174
if (this.cloudEvent == null) return;
175-
this.cloudEvent.Extensions.Remove(name);
175+
this.cloudEvent.ExtensionAttributes.Remove(name);
176176
this.StateHasChanged();
177177
}
178178

179179
private void OnAddExtensionAttribute()
180180
{
181181
if (this.cloudEvent == null) this.cloudEvent = V1Event.Create();
182182
Neuroglia.Serialization.Dynamic dynamic = (string.IsNullOrWhiteSpace(this.extensionAttribute.Value) ? null : Neuroglia.Serialization.Dynamic.FromObject(this.extensionAttribute.Value))!;
183-
if (this.cloudEvent.Extensions == null) this.cloudEvent.Extensions = new();
184-
this.cloudEvent.Extensions[this.extensionAttribute.Name] = dynamic;
183+
if (this.cloudEvent.ExtensionAttributes == null) this.cloudEvent.ExtensionAttributes = new();
184+
this.cloudEvent.ExtensionAttributes[this.extensionAttribute.Name] = dynamic;
185185
this.extensionAttribute = new();
186186
this.StateHasChanged();
187187
}

src/dashboard/Synapse.Dashboard/Features/Shared/SearchBox/SearchBox.razor.min.css

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)